Job Title: Massage Therapy Instructor
Location: Onsite, Ha milton Campus, 20 Hughson St S, Suite 800, Hamilton ON, L8N 2A1
Hours: Part-Time. Monday to Friday, 9:00 am - 1:00 pm for 2 to 3 days a week
Start Date: September 7, 2026
End Date: December 18, 2026
Compensation: $35/hr - $40/hr
The primary responsibilities of this position are to provide quality delivery of assigned Massage Therapy courses utilizing a variety of instruction strategies, techniques, and delivery methods to meet the individual learning styles of the students, in a safe and civil learning environment. Instructors are responsible for teaching assigned courses in accordance with course competencies, taking daily attendance, and grading class tests, assignments, and exams.
